<blockquote>Reviews aggregation site Metacritic has revealed its 2009 Game Platform Power Rankings charts, and it’s the PS3 that has emerged as this year’s champion.

The chart combines a number of factors but is designed to name the platform that has consistently delivered the best quality software over the last 12 months.

Xbox 360 was the console that actually finished with the highest number of positively reviewed games, with 88 titles scoring 75 or higher overall. In addition, the Wii received the highest number of new titles – 362 throughout the year.</blockquote>
